

/* Start:/bitrix/templates/goodlight/components/bitrix/news/commercial_offer/bitrix/news.detail/.default/style.css?15704655032834*/
@media print{
	.print{font-family: 'Roboto', sans-serif;}
	.page-break-after{page-break-after: always;}
	a{text-decoration: none; color: #4e515f;}
	a:hover {color: #000;}
}
.commercial-title-1{
	font-size: 36px;
	line-height: 38px;
	font-weight: 500;
	text-align: center;
	margin: 0 10px 40px;
	color: #4e515f;
}
.commercial-title-2{
	font-size: 24px;
	line-height: 18px;
	font-weight: 600;
	text-align: center;
	margin: 0 5px 30px;
	color: #4e515f;
}
.commercial-title-3{
	font-size: 20px;
	line-height: 20px;
	font-weight: 600;
	text-align: center;
	margin: 0 3px 25px;
	color: #4e515f;
}
.commercial-p{
	font-size: 16px;
	line-height: 18px;
	font-weight: 400;
	text-align: center;
	margin: 0 2px 35px;
	color: #4e515f;
}
.commercial-table, .commercial-table-2{
	width: 100%;
	margin-bottom: 40px;
	border-collapse: collapse;
}
.commercial-table{
	border-top: 1px solid #666;
	border-left: 1px solid #666;
}
.commercial-table th, .commercial-table td{
	border-bottom: 1px solid #666;
	border-right: 1px solid #666;
	padding: 14px 5px;
	color: #4e515f;
}
.commercial-table td{
	vertical-align: top;
	font-size: 16px;
	line-height: 18px;
	font-weight: 400;
}
.commercial-table td a, .commercial-table-2 td a, .commercial-signature a{
	color: #4e515f;
}
.commercial-table td a:hover, .commercial-table-2 td a:hover, .commercial-signature a:hover{
	color: #000;
}
.commercial-table th{
	font-size: 18px;
	line-height: 18px;
	font-weight: 600;
	text-align: center;
}
.commercialImg{
	max-width: 300px;
	width: 100%;
}
@media print{
	.commercialImg{
		width: 150px;
	}
}
.commercial-table-2{
	border-bottom: 1px solid #666;
}
.commercial-table-2 th, .commercial-table-2 td{
	padding: 14px 5px;
	color: #4e515f;
}
.commercial-table-2 th{
	font-size: 14px;
	line-height: 18px;
	font-weight: 500;
	text-align: center;
	border-bottom: 1px solid #666;
}
.commercial-table-2 tr th:nth-child(3){
	min-width: 125px;
}
.commercial-table-2 tr th:nth-child(4){
	min-width: 150px;
}
.commercial-table-2 td{
	vertical-align: bottom;
	font-size: 16px;
	line-height: 18px;
	font-weight: 400;
	text-align: right;
	padding: 20px;
}
.commercial-table-2 tr td:first-child{
	text-align: left;
}
.totalPrice{
	text-align: right;
	font-weight: 600;
}
.commercial-note{
	font-size: 16px;
	line-height: 18px;
	font-weight: 400;
	padding: 0 40px 35px;
	color: #4e515f;
}
.commercial-pechat{
	text-align: center;
}
.commercial-signature{
	text-align: right;
	padding: 0 10px 20px;
}
.header-pdf{
	background: #3d4256;
	padding: 20pt 27pt 10pt 50pt;

}
.header-pdf-table{
	background: #3d4256;
}
.first-cell{
	border-right: 1px solid #fff;
	padding-right: 30pt;
}
.second-cell{
	padding-left: 17pt;
	color:#fff;
	font-size: 10pt;
}
@page :first {
 margin-top: 0;
}
@page{
 margin-left: 0;
 margin-right: 0;
}
.print-padding{
	margin-left: 2cm;
	margin-right: 2cm;
}
/* End */
/* /bitrix/templates/goodlight/components/bitrix/news/commercial_offer/bitrix/news.detail/.default/style.css?15704655032834 */
